Mostrando entradas con la etiqueta java practice. Mostrar todas las entradas
Mostrando entradas con la etiqueta java practice. Mostrar todas las entradas

domingo, 19 de junio de 2016

Curso de Java Clase 6: Bucle For y bucles anidados


Para ver en youtube click aquí
Para ir a la lista de repoducción del curso click aquí
Para ir a la lista de reproducción de los ejercicios click aquí
Para ir a mi canal de youtube click aquí  (Recuerda suscribirte)

    Acabas de ver lo que es el bucle for, quizás te estés preguntando: ¿Que diferencia tiene con el bucle while? La respuesta corta es en esencia ninguna ya que todos los bucles hacen prácticamente lo mismo, pero al tener una sintaxis y una implementación diferente estos se pueden adaptar a situaciones diferentes, eres tú como programador el que decide que bucle se adapta mejor al código que estas escribiendo.

Números del 1 al 100

  En el video viste el siguiente ejemplo:
package clase6;

public class Clase6 {

    public static void main(String[] args) {
        for(int i=0; i<=10; i++){
           System.out.println(i);
        }
    }

}

For con dos condiciones

package clase6;

public class Clase6 {

    public static void main(String[] args) {
    int num = 0;
        for(int i=0; i<=10; i++){
           num++;
           if(num >= 10){
             System.out.print(i);
             num = 0;
           }
          System.out.println("");
        }
    }

}

Bucles anidados

  El siguiente ejemplo escribe un "cuadro" de números usando un bucle while, dentro de un bucle for
package clase6;

public class Clase6 {

    public static void main(String[] args) {
        for(int i=0; i<=10; i++){
            int num = 0;
            while(num <= 10){
                System.out.print(i);
                num++;
            }
            System.out.println("");
        }
    }

}